Recap: Wood Wildcats vs. Lowell Cardinals
It's hard to turn regular season success into postseason wins, a fact the Wood Wildcats can now relate to. They took a 52-48 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Cardinals. Wood has now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Loss or not, Wood got some senior leadership from Natalia Sanchez and Tianna Palmer. Sanchez almost dropped a double-double on 14 points and nine rebounds, while Palmer. scored 12 points along with eight rebounds and four steals. Palmer has been hot recently, having posted two or more steals the last eight times she's played. Sa?nyah Stewart was another key contributor, scoring seven points along with three steals.
Wood's loss dropped their record down to 19-13. As for Lowell, they are on a roll lately: they've won six of their last seven contests, which provided a nice bump to their 18-12 record this season.
Wood does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Lowell, they will head out on the road to face off against Trinity at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. Trinity will roll in looking for their seventh straight win, something Lowell surely won't give up without a fight.
